Output 8c95eb574d4e81a724a166340796cc16bbe34d4b3166fa48ea9bdb31650e7ccc:0

value
160000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8607f4d604b15f62af5bfff5bfd469a1113b1dfa OP_EQUALVERIFY OP_CHECKSIG
address
1DDh5XT52X1AguxBZhTjeq4rWdm7NxfMXW
transaction
8c95eb574d4e81a724a166340796cc16bbe34d4b3166fa48ea9bdb31650e7ccc
confirmations
463388
spent
true